Transnomino is an app designed to help individuals to handle multiple files and perform various operations, such as adding numbers to the filenames or applying regular expressions.
It has a standard user interface, with a black background theme, responsive buttons, and an intuitive main menu. There are no theme customizations and the text size in some areas could've been bigger. The memory consumption is quite low, so you don't have to own a high-end system.
With Transnomino, individuals are able to find and replace files using regular expressions, remove diacritics, add numbering to filenames, or convert files into compatible OS versions. The app supports multiple renaming modes, as well as batch processing. Moreover, the items can easily be rearranged with its drag-and-drop function, characters can be trimmed from the start or the end, and suffixes or prefixes can be added to the filenames.
Overall, Transnomino is a useful app for managing files and folders. It includes a few interesting features, it's free, and doesn't have major flaws.
